Community Advocate Resource Education
JTM advocates for all victims of violence — human trafficking, sexual assault, and domestic violence. Our trained advocates walk alongside survivors, connecting them to safety, services, and long-term support.
What We Do
Advocacy for victims of violence
Initial training requires two in-person, three-hour sessions. Pre-registration is required. Cost is $40. Please note that a background check is required.

Where We Serve
Serving Walworth County and beyond
We are a collaboration of agencies and churches providing help and advocacy for all victims of violence. Our advocates are deployed to hospitals, advocacy centers, and correctional facilities throughout the region.

Community Support
CARE Bags
We provide CARE Bags filled with toiletries that may meet just a basic need. The items are all donated by community members and organizations who care.

International program
The C.A.R.E. mission extends to Kenya
16 community leaders in Nairobi formed ViBE — Vision Beyond Eyes — bringing this movement to an international stage.
